Great little coffee shop located inside(and run by) the Laramie County Library. Serves coffee and tea, other drinks and snacks. You can take your food and drinks into the library. Wifi is available throughout the library including the café. You will need a library card or a visitor’s pass(available for $ 1 good for the entire day) to use it.
